实时视频SDK如何实现视频直播社交?

随着互联网技术的飞速发展,实时视频SDK在视频直播社交领域的应用越来越广泛。本文将深入探讨如何利用实时视频SDK实现视频直播社交,并分析其优势及案例。

实时视频SDK简介

实时视频SDK(Software Development Kit)是一种提供实时音视频通信功能的软件开发工具包。它能够帮助开发者快速集成音视频功能,实现实时视频直播、语音通话、视频会议等功能。

实时视频SDK实现视频直播社交的优势

  1. 实时互动:实时视频SDK支持实时音视频传输,用户可以实时看到对方,增加互动性,提高社交体验。
  2. 降低开发成本:使用实时视频SDK,开发者无需从零开始开发音视频功能,可以快速实现视频直播社交功能。
  3. 跨平台支持:实时视频SDK支持多种平台,如iOS、Android、Web等,方便用户在不同设备上使用。
  4. 安全性高:实时视频SDK采用加密技术,确保音视频传输的安全性,保护用户隐私。

如何利用实时视频SDK实现视频直播社交

  1. 选择合适的实时视频SDK:根据项目需求,选择适合的实时视频SDK,如腾讯云实时音视频、Agora等。
  2. 集成SDK:将实时视频SDK集成到项目中,按照文档说明进行配置。
  3. 开发直播功能:利用SDK提供的API,实现推流、拉流、互动等功能。
  4. 优化用户体验:针对不同场景,优化音视频质量,提高用户满意度。

案例分析

以某视频直播社交平台为例,该平台利用实时视频SDK实现了以下功能:

  1. 实时视频直播:用户可以实时观看主播的直播内容,与主播互动。
  2. 语音聊天:用户可以与主播或其他用户进行语音聊天,增加互动性。
  3. 礼物打赏:用户可以通过打赏礼物表达对主播的支持。

通过实时视频SDK,该平台实现了高效、稳定的音视频传输,吸引了大量用户,取得了良好的市场口碑。

总之,实时视频SDK在视频直播社交领域的应用具有广阔前景。开发者可以根据自身需求,选择合适的SDK,实现视频直播社交功能,提升用户体验。

猜你喜欢:跨境电商网络怎么解决